LANSING, Minn. (May 23, 2025)—Chateau Speedway hosted an action-packed Friday night of racing during the Hall of Fame Night, featuring the Summit USRA Weekly Racing Series.

The event honored racing legends while delivering thrilling competition in the USRA Stock Cars and USRA Hobby Stocks divisions, with drivers battling for top spots on the historic oval.

In the USRA Stock Car Feature, Stacy Krohnberg of Walters took the checkered flag, starting from the third position. P.J. Duchene of Faribault followed closely in second, with Jason Schlangen of Cresco, Iowa, securing third.

Andrew Eischens of Taopi claimed fourth, and Jackson Vsetecka of Fort Atkinson, Iowa, rounded out the top five.

The USRA Hobby Stock Feature saw Jason Newkirk of Austin dominate from the third starting spot to claim the victory. Terry Quam of Cresco, Iowa, finished a strong second, while Steve Dwyer of La Crosse, Wis., took third.

Jack Paulson of Morristown charged to fourth, and Caden Helle of Garnavillo, Iowa, completed the top five.

The event, steeped in tradition, celebrated the legacy of Chateau Speedway’s Hall of Fame inductees, adding extra significance to the night’s races. Fans filled the grandstands, enjoying a mix of nostalgia and high-speed action under the lights.

The United States Racing Association (USRA) was formed in 2002, and currently sanctions eight divisions at some of the finest speedways in America. With the incredible support of dozens of marketing partners, the USRA is able to provide points funds and contingency awards that are second to none in dirt track racing. Thousands of racers compete in the Summit USRA Weekly Racing Series at some of the most elite dirt track facilities in America.

The 12th Annual Summit USRA Nationals happens Sept. 30 through Oct. 4 at the legendary Lucas Oil Speedway in Wheatland, Mo., featuring USRA Modifieds, USRA Stock Cars, USRA B-Mods, USRA Hobby Stocks and USRA Tuners in their Summit USRA Weekly Racing Series national points finales.

The 6th Annual Summit USRA Southern Nationals returns to the Boothill Speedway in Greenwood, La., from Oct. 16-18, featuring USRA Limited Mods and Sunoco USRA Factory Stocks in their final Summit USRA Weekly Racing Series national points event.
